Email: Thursday, 23 May 2013

It is my understanding that the Tech class on last Saturday/Sunday had 17 students and all took and passed their Tech exams.  We also had six currently licensed and four of them earned license upgrades, two to General and two to Extra.  Finally, of our Tech class, one made the leap all the way from no license to General.  Way to go, guys and gals!  They (and we) have a few more days to wait and see what the FCC finds for them in the "new call" out basket.

Our thanks to Gordon NQ4K, Duane K4UW, Charlie K3SR, Paul K4PDF, Jim KF4PQL and Kevin W4KLS who ably assisted in the registration and check-in of those taking the exams, proctoring the test-takers, scoring the exams, and patiently waiting while I did my best to pull all the paperwork together and get the "I's" dotted and "T's" crossed.  By my count going back to the first of our most recent 5 VE sessions, we have aided 72 people to get their initial ham licenses.

Now, let's reach out and see if any of them need Elmering to make sure they get on the air and begin to explore the wonderful world of ham radio, and encourage a few more to come join us for Field Day and for future club meetings.
